Output 75679eeb24194060f13c145d02a5e15f74a102b9722db4c41ee23ee8e8ebeae2:1

value
16095582
script pubkey
OP_0 OP_PUSHBYTES_20 31dbbb06c80d119050661653bafe9c9a3ef96834
address
ltc1qx8dmkpkgp5geq5rxzefm4l5ungl0j6p5959t7t
transaction
75679eeb24194060f13c145d02a5e15f74a102b9722db4c41ee23ee8e8ebeae2
spent
true